Any thoughts out there on whether it's a good idea (or not) to rub BRITU and then bag for 24 hours? I'm concerned about the potential "salty" issue, even though I plan to go sparingly on the rub. Good afternoon David:

Please save face and money by taking Jim's advice. July fourth I applied rub overnight to three beautiful racks of baby backs and paid the exact price you suspect. They looked and smelled wonderful but I learned how a slug (snail) feels when one applies salt to his back!

Thanks guys, I've dodged THAT bullet.... The ribs are awaiting a gentle sprinkling tomorrow late morning. I saw on the original BRITU recipe at the bottom of the page to apply rub two hours prior to smoking. I figured there was a reason for posting that question (as John sadly found out).
